What is 14 3 Wire?

The 14 3 wire refers to a type of electrical cable that contains three insulated conductors and a bare copper ground wire. The three insulated conductors are typically color-coded as black, red, and white. The black and red wires are hot wires, while the white wire is the neutral wire. The bare copper wire serves as the ground wire, providing a safe path for electrical current in case of a short circuit.

Components of 14 3 Wire

The 14 3 wire cable is composed of the following components:

  • Black Wire: This is one of the hot wires and is used to carry the electrical current from the power source to the switch or device.
  • Red Wire: This is the second hot wire and is often used in three-way and four-way switch configurations to provide power to the switch from a different location.
  • White Wire: This is the neutral wire and completes the circuit by returning the electrical current to the power source.
  • Bare Copper Wire: This is the ground wire and provides a safe path for electrical current in case of a short circuit, helping to prevent electrical shocks and fires.

Applications of 14 3 Wire

The 14 3 wire is commonly used in various electrical applications, including:

  • Three-Way Switches: These switches allow you to control a single light fixture from two different locations. The 14 3 wire is essential for connecting the two switches and the light fixture.
  • Four-Way Switches: These switches allow you to control a single light fixture from three or more locations. The 14 3 wire is used to connect the switches in a series, enabling multiple control points.
  • Lighting Circuits: The 14 3 wire is often used in lighting circuits to provide power to multiple light fixtures from a single power source.
  • Outlets and Switches: In some cases, the 14 3 wire is used to provide power to outlets and switches in a circuit, allowing for flexible wiring configurations.

Troubleshooting 14 3 Wire

If you encounter issues with your 14 3 wire installation, here are some common troubleshooting steps:

  • Check Connections: Ensure that all wire connections are secure and properly tightened. Loose connections can cause intermittent power issues.
  • Verify Wire Colors: Double-check that the wire colors are correctly connected to the appropriate terminals on the switches and light fixtures.
  • Test for Continuity: Use a multimeter to test for continuity between the wires. This can help identify any breaks or shorts in the wiring.
  • Inspect for Damage: Look for any signs of damage to the wires, such as frayed insulation or exposed conductors. Replace any damaged wires as needed.
  • Check the Circuit Breaker: Ensure that the circuit breaker for the circuit is not tripped. If it is, reset it and see if the issue persists.

Understanding Three-Way and Four-Way Switches

Three-way and four-way switches are commonly used in conjunction with 14 3 wire to provide flexible control of lighting from multiple locations. Here’s a brief overview of how these switches work:

Three-Way Switches

A three-way switch allows you to control a single light fixture from two different locations. The 14 3 wire is used to connect the two switches and the light fixture. The switches have three terminals: a common terminal and two traveler terminals. The common terminal is connected to the hot wire from the power source, while the traveler terminals are connected to the traveler wires that run between the two switches.

Four-Way Switches

A four-way switch allows you to control a single light fixture from three or more locations. The 14 3 wire is used to connect the switches in a series, enabling multiple control points. Four-way switches have four terminals: two pairs of traveler terminals. The traveler wires from the three-way switches are connected to the traveler terminals on the four-way switch, allowing for flexible control of the light fixture.
